Output 86d49fefb9f315fde804b42267a3ddec003009d6f37de17f9bdacd7e85263b0c:86

value
80786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258f64c4421a049f0b4159f8fc590dfe33d58a01 OP_EQUAL
address
357chodjVsDqvmSK6Vf6HGG9sqivT53Cj9
transaction
86d49fefb9f315fde804b42267a3ddec003009d6f37de17f9bdacd7e85263b0c
spent
true